Siemens is looking for a Plant IT Support Person for our location in Pomona, CA.
This role involves providing technical support and maintenance for our IT systems and infrastructure. The ideal candidate is expected to demonstrate a solid technical background, excellent problem-solving skills, and a customer-focused approach. You will be responsible for ensuring the smooth operation of our IT systems and providing timely support to our staff. The schedule for first 3 months for training would be 8am to 5pm, and then transition to a 10am to 7pm once trained Responsibilities:
- Provide technical assistance and support for incoming queries related to computer systems, software, and hardware.
- Diagnose and resolve technical hardware and software issues in a manufacturing environment.
- Install, configure, and upgrade computer components and software.
- Collaborate with IT team members to design and implement technology solutions that support manufacturing processes.
- Assist with the onboarding and offboarding of all corporate employees, ensuring a smooth transition for their IT needs.
- Manage on site inventory and the total lifecycle of IT assets.
- Write instructional documentation and convey highly technical ideas in terms that nontechnical people can understand. Requirements:
You will win us over by having the following qualifications:
Basic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ology is required.
- 2-4 years of experience in industrial IT environments.
- Solid grasp of manufacturing processes, related technologies, and capability to fix different hardware and software issues.
- Familiarity with networking, server management, and cybersecurity protocols.
- Must be physically fit enough to regularly lift up to 50 lbs. for duties (i.e. delivering computers, unpacking and rack-mounting equipment).
- Must be available evenings, holidays, and weekends as the need arises.
- Basic Technical Certification A+ / Network+ / Microsoft Certifications (MCP, MCSA, MCITP)
- Legally authorized to work in the United States on a continual and permanent basis without company sponsorship
Preferred Qualifications:
- Proficiency in ERP software (e.g., S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Dynamics) and related modules. Technical Skills:
- Networking Protocols: Understanding of TCP/IP and Ethernet.
- Industrial Standards: Familiarity with Profinet and Modbus.
- Cybersecurity Practices: Proficiency in standard methodologies for cybersecurity.
- Skills in running Windows and Linux workstations.
- Experience with various virtualization technologies.
- Competence in mobile device management systems.

We are a global technology company focused on industry, infrastructure, transport, and healthcare. From more resource-efficient factories, resilient supply chains, and smarter buildings and grids, to sustainable transportation as well as advanced healthcare, we create technology with purpose adding real value for customers.
Siemens Corporation is a U.S. subsidiary of Siemens AG, a leading technology company focused on industry, infrastructure, transport, and healthcare. From more resource-efficient factories, resilient supply chains, and smarter buildings and grids, to cleaner and more comfortable transportation as well as advanced healthcare, the company creates technology with purpose adding real value for customers. By combining the real and the digital worlds, Siemens empowers its customers to transform their industries and markets, helping them to transform the everyday for billions of people. Siemens also owns a majority stake in the publicly listed company Siemens Healthineers, a globally leading medical technology provider shaping the future of healthcare. In fiscal 2023, which ended on September 30, 2023, the Siemens Group USA generated revenue of $19.9 billion and employs approximately 45,000 people serving customers in all 50 states and Puerto Rico.
